In a quaint village nestled at the foot of these majestic mountains, lived a young girl named Ling. Her eyes held the wisdom of the ages, and her spirit danced with the wildness of the wind. Ling was no ordinary girl; she was the descendant of the ancient sages who once guarded the secrets of the Shan Hai Jing, the Book of Mountains and Seas. Her destiny was to unravel the mysteries of the Golden Serpent, a task that had eluded her ancestors for centuries.

One moonlit night, as the silver glow of the moon bathed the mountains in a ghostly light, Ling stood at the edge of the village,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and excitement. She had received a vision, a vision that had led her to this very place. The Golden Serpent was not just a creature of myth; it was the key to the eternal cycle of life and death, and it resided in the heart of the forbidden peak, the Peak of Eternity.

Ling's journey began with a silent vow to her ancestors. She would face the serpent, whatever the cost. The village elder, an ancient man with eyes that had seen many seasons, handed her a small, ornate scroll. "This scroll," he said, "contains the incantation that will protect you from the serpent's curse. But remember, Ling, the path is fraught with peril, and the true test lies not in your strength, but in your heart."

With the scroll in hand, Ling set off into the unknown. The path was treacherous, winding through dense forests and over treacherous cliffs. She encountered creatures both benign and malevolent, each testing her resolve. The air grew colder as she ascended, and the whispers of the mountains grew louder, their voices a haunting reminder of the serpent's presence.

At the peak, the air was thin, and the wind howled like a living thing. Ling found herself at the edge of a cliff, the ground beneath her feet crumbling. She looked down and saw the abyss that lay below, a chasm that seemed to stretch into infinity. In the distance, she saw the silhouette of a massive creature, its scales glinting in the moonlight.

The Golden Serpent moved with a grace that belied its fearsome nature. It watched Ling with eyes that held the wisdom of the ages. "You have come," it said, its voice a rumble that echoed through the mountains. "You seek the eternal life that I offer, but you must understand the cost."

Ling stepped forward, her heart pounding. "I seek not just life, but understanding. I wish to learn the secrets of the universe, to see beyond the veil of time and space."

The serpent's eyes softened. "Then you have passed the first test. You have come with a pure heart, not seeking power for yourself, but for the greater good."

The serpent then spoke of the cycle of life and death, of the balance that must be maintained for the world to continue. It revealed to Ling the ancient incantation, a series of words that would allow her to communicate with the spirit world and unlock the secrets of the Shan Hai Jing.

As the first light of dawn broke over the mountains, Ling knew her journey was far from over. She had faced the Golden Serpent and emerged victorious, but the true challenge lay ahead. She would need to use the knowledge she had gained to protect her village and the world from the dark forces that sought to disrupt the natural order.

With the scroll of the incantation tucked safely in her belt, Ling descended the Peak of Eternity, her heart filled with a newfound sense of purpose. The village elder watched her leave, a knowing smile on his face. He had seen this day coming, and he knew that Ling would rise to the occasion.
